Loaded up the canoe and headed north Friday. Sat was a long, enjoyable venture 5 miles in by canoe (with 2hp motor) to "my spot". Since I did not make it there last year, I was anxious to check out last year's rut sign to see what I "missed". My saddle crossing was looking great with a lot of rubs and scrapes nearby. Was especially hyped by finding buck bed on side of ridge about 500 feet from saddle. This put some "pieces" together and I now have a 2nd stand over a great looking ridgeside trail about 200 yards from saddle crossing. 3rd stand is a marsh corner stand that is especially good aft and evenings. So all 3 spots are figured, now just need to head in Aug or Sep and prepare the one new stand with a little trimming. Plan is to hunt N.Minn Oct 28-Nov 6, then to Bayfield Cty, Wis thru Nov 15th.
